New Spirit Board event for Super Smash Bros. Ultimate is called Chain the Future to Spirits! featuring Astral Chain characters

Nintendo has announced the next Spirit Board event for Super Smash Bros. Ultimate. The latest in-game event revolves around spirits from the Nintendo Switch game Astral Chain. Read on below for more details: Starting on 1/17 for 5 days, the #SmashBrosUltimate spirit event "Chain the Future to Spirits!" will be held. New amiibo Tag Tournament event announced for Super Smash Bros. Ultimate

Nintendo has announced the next in-game event for Super Smash Bros. Ultimate. It's officially called Challenge with Raised amiibo: Tag Tournament. Read on below for more details: "This tourney is just for fighters and stages that appeared in Super Smash Bros. Melee! Even the items that appear come from Melee!
